IPgallery Announces Availability of the Next Generation Adaptation Platform
June 3, 2008, Atlanta, GA -- IPgallery today announced the availability of the NGN Adaptation Platform, or NAP. The NAP provides network mediation services that in essence convert an operator’s existing, legacy environment into an all-IP environment without replacing or changing existing switches. In doing so, the NAP enables the convergence of multiple networks (legacy, NGN, IMS) and introduces central provisioning and management of all network elements and the sharing of applications across different networks types. This enables operators to deploy advanced services on top of existing network infrastructure and leverage existing services such as prepaid, 800 etc in the NGN/IMS core network environment.
